Output 7a7599660155b21d7685732c81100932c4fcffe21ab2e051cf1df7bb101f6881:1

value
2861590
script pubkey
OP_0 OP_PUSHBYTES_20 b3dfde727ea46a0bf9a36e7e71fcc5a9cf198da7
address
ltc1qk00auun7534qh7drdel8rlx94883nrd82pmmlz
transaction
7a7599660155b21d7685732c81100932c4fcffe21ab2e051cf1df7bb101f6881
spent
true